Reverse gear out!!
I have a 96monte carlo ls 3.1 and the trans was slippina few times and I added Lucas transfix to it. Now it just stopped going in reverse but all the other gears work. I was thinking about a trans flush and ew filter but Im not sure if that will solve it. Im trying to see if i can fix it withut a rebuild because if i have to rebuild the tranny il jts have to scrap it.

Re: Reverse gear out!!
The one possibility is to check the reverse servo from the outside. The servo cover can be removed and the servo piston and seals can be removed and inspected.
![]() It may also be possible to verify that the reverse band is holding the input drum or if the band or anchor are damaged. A line pressure test and scan should reveal whether the reverse solenoid is operating, and that the valves are complying. You'll have to determine if the vehicle is worth the diagnostic time.
